Transaction 17ac1af737cdc8507504630f84ea459c2bc69f3bb99ff9692313dd0cf691bd6c
1 Input
1 Output
-
17ac1af737cdc8507504630f84ea459c2bc69f3bb99ff9692313dd0cf691bd6c:0
- value
- 1844860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57b154bc353fd08e8752b98b26c8677c26e6b84a OP_EQUAL
- address
- 39gh9QYGnATKe64zWax4ZUT69CuN2betFG